ISU sesquicentennial concluding ceremonyApril 12, 2008 Follwing the Veishea parade DescriptionIowa State's year-long sesquicentennial celebration concludes April 12 on central campus, following the Veishea parade. The short ceremony will include a talk by President Gregory Geoffroy, a salute recognizing military science's strong role in university history and the awarding of Iowa State's new "True and Valiant Award." In addition, Geoffroy will dedicate a new seating area near the Campanile, a gift from the sesquicentennial committee commemorating the university's 150th celebration. LocationCentral campus |
